Advertisement

基于QT5的图书管理系统的MySQL数据库设计

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本项目基于QT5框架开发,专注于设计并实现一个高效的图书管理系统。通过优化的MySQL数据库设计,确保系统在数据存储、检索及维护方面表现卓越。 本设计基于QT Creator及MySQL数据库平台开发,是一个典型的图书管理系统(MIS)。本段落详细介绍了系统的整个分析、设计与实现过程,包括需求分析、功能模块的设计、数据模式的分析以及系统前台的实现。经过测试运行的结果表明,所设计的图书管理系统能够满足读者和图书馆双方的需求。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• QT5MySQL
    优质
    本项目基于QT5框架开发,专注于设计并实现一个高效的图书管理系统。通过优化的MySQL数据库设计,确保系统在数据存储、检索及维护方面表现卓越。 本设计基于QT Creator及MySQL数据库平台开发,是一个典型的图书管理系统(MIS)。本段落详细介绍了系统的整个分析、设计与实现过程,包括需求分析、功能模块的设计、数据模式的分析以及系统前台的实现。经过测试运行的结果表明,所设计的图书管理系统能够满足读者和图书馆双方的需求。
  • MySQL
    优质
    本系统为图书管理定制开发,采用MySQL数据库技术构建。旨在提高图书资料的管理效率与准确性,支持书籍信息录入、查询及维护等功能。 此数据库系统是基于MySQL设计的,包含了一对一和一对多的关系,并且存储过程和存储函数可以正常调用,适合初学者参考和学习。
  • MySQL.doc
    优质
    本文档详细介绍了基于MySQL的图书管理系统的数据库设计方案,包括表结构、字段定义以及数据关系等关键内容。 本段落介绍了基于MySQL的图书管理系统数据库设计,涵盖需求分析、概要设计及程序设计等内容。在需求分析部分,从功能需求与数据需求两个角度进行了详尽阐述,并讨论了数据安全与约束问题。概要设计中,则讲解了实体及其关联关系和ER图,并概述了逻辑结构设计中的数据库模型以及函数依赖集。在程序设计方面,详细描述了图书管理系统的各个功能模块及主要模块的功能说明,并提供了包括表设计、初始化数据、单表查询和借阅等功能的源代码。
  • MySQL.docx
    优质
    本文档详细介绍了以MySQL为平台的图书管理系统的数据库设计方案,包括数据库结构、表关系及字段定义等内容。 基于MySQL的图书管理系统数据库设计涉及创建一个高效且易于管理的数据结构来存储图书馆的各种数据。这包括但不限于书籍的信息、借阅记录、用户账户以及管理员权限等功能模块的设计与实现,以确保系统的稳定性和可扩展性。通过合理规划表之间的关系和字段类型的选择,可以优化查询效率并简化业务逻辑的开发过程。
  • MySQL.docx
    优质
    本文档详细介绍了基于MySQL的图书管理系统的数据库设计方案,包括表结构、数据关系及实现方法等内容。 基于MySQL的图书管理系统数据库设计涉及创建一个高效且易于维护的数据架构,用于存储、检索及管理图书馆的各种数据。这包括书籍的基本信息(如书名、作者、ISBN等),借阅记录以及用户资料等功能模块的设计与实现。 在设计过程中,需要考虑关系表之间的关联性,并采用适当的关系模型来优化查询性能和数据完整性。此外,还需要确保数据库的安全性和稳定性,在实际应用中能够满足图书管理的各项需求。
  • MySQL.doc
    优质
    本文档详细介绍了基于MySQL的图书管理系统的数据库设计方案,包括数据表结构、关系建模及优化策略等内容。适合系统开发人员和数据库管理员参考学习。 本段落档旨在设计一个基于MySQL的图书管理系统数据库,以提升图书馆管理和借阅效率。该系统涵盖的功能包括但不限于:图书管理、读者管理、借书流程处理(如借书、还书、挂失等)、综合查询以及各类统计分析。 一、概述 当前部分图书馆工作仍依赖手工操作,这不仅导致工作效率低下,而且不利于资源的充分管理和动态调整。此外,手动记录容易产生错误和遗漏。因此,为提高管理效率并满足师生对图书借阅的需求,学校计划引入计算机管理系统,并基于MySQL设计相应的数据库。 二、需求分析 2.1 功能需求 本系统将提供以下功能: - 图书管理:入库操作、资料维护及信息查询。 - 读者服务:用户注册、账户更新与个人信息检索等。 - 借阅处理:包括借还书籍,挂失和续借手续等流程。 - 查询服务:实现多样化的图书或读者数据查找方式。 - 统计分析:对各类图书数量及库存进行统计,并追踪特定时间段内的借阅频率、预约情况以及个人阅读习惯。 2.2 数据需求 系统将采用MySQL数据库,使用关系型数据库架构来组织和存储信息。具体的数据包括: - 图书详情:如ISBN号、标题、作者姓名等。 - 读者档案:例如用户ID、全名及相关联系信息等。 三、概要设计 该方案计划利用MySQL平台构建系统,并通过ER图展示实体间的关系,明确逻辑结构的设计目标及方法。 四、详细设计 本阶段将深入探讨数据库的逻辑模型及其依赖关系: - 数据库模式:确定各实体和属性以及它们之间的连接方式。 - 函数依赖集:定义数据间的相互作用规则,保障信息的一致性和准确性。 五、程序开发 在此环节中,我们将具体实现各项功能模块,并编写相关代码以支持数据库的创建与维护工作: - 系统主要组件及其操作说明 - 数据库设计文档(含表结构) 六、运行环境描述 该系统将部署于MySQL平台上,利用关系型数据库技术进行数据管理。所需软硬件配置如下所述。 七、参考资料 本项目参考了多种资源和标准文件,主要包括关于MySQL的相关资料和技术论文等文献。 综上所述,通过开发基于MySQL的图书管理系统数据库,可以显著改善图书馆的工作效率和服务质量,并为用户提供更便捷的操作体验。
  • MySQL
    优质
    本系统为图书馆量身打造,采用MySQL数据库技术,实现高效便捷的图书管理。它涵盖图书信息录入、借阅查询及库存更新等核心功能,旨在优化日常运营流程,提升用户体验与资源利用率。 以前使用的是SQL Server数据库管理系统,现在已将数据库移植为MySQL,并且其他部分没有任何改动。如果需要下载之前的版本,请参考相关资源页面。
  • 》课程报告——MySQL
    优质
    本课程设计报告围绕《数据库系统原理》课程要求,详细阐述了基于MySQL的图书管理系统的数据库设计方案,包括需求分析、概念模型设计及逻辑结构实现等内容。 《数据库系统原理》设计报告 基于MySQL的图书管理系统数据库设计
  • MySQL实现
    优质
    本项目旨在通过MySQL设计并实施一个高效的图书管理系统数据库。它涵盖了图书、作者、出版社等实体及其关系的设计与优化,以支持各类查询和操作需求。 图书管理系统数据库设计在MySQL中的实现。
  • MySQL实现
    优质
    本项目旨在通过MySQL实现一个功能完备的图书管理系统数据库。涵盖图书、用户及借阅等核心模块的设计与优化,确保高效的数据管理和访问。 图书管理系统数据库设计是数据库课程设计中的一个重要实践项目,主要使用MySQL数据库实现。系统的主要目标是高效、便捷地管理图书馆的图书资源,同时满足学生和管理员的不同需求。 该系统的目的是简化图书管理工作,允许学生通过借阅终端查询书籍信息和个人借阅记录。核心功能包括学生的借阅与归还操作、信息注册、图书信息更新以及管理员对图书和学生信息的管理等。 在需求分析阶段,我们明确了以下几点: 1. 学生可以查询书籍信息及个人借阅记录,在进行借书时需登录并验证身份。 2. 借书会同步更新图书馆中图书的状态和学生的借阅记录。 3. 在借书前学生需要先注册个人信息;归还图书只需提供图书编码即可完成操作。 4. 管理员可以修改书籍信息、添加或删除书籍,同时能够处理学生的注销请求。 系统功能模块设计包括以下几个部分: 1. 学生模块:主要包括学生注册、登录、查询书籍和借阅及归还等操作。 2. 管理员模块:涵盖管理员登录、图书管理(如修改书目信息)、学生信息管理和可能的罚款处理等功能。 3. 系统维护模块:用于数据库备份恢复以及性能优化。 在设计过程中,我们首先基于E-R模型进行方案规划。这些模型展示了实体(例如学生、书籍和管理员)及其关系,并形成总体E-R图和局部细节图如借阅-归还等场景的描述。 具体表的设计如下: 1. student:包含学号(主键)、姓名、性别、年龄、专业及年级。 2. book:包括书籍序号(主键)、书名、作者信息、出版社名称以及在架状态和分类标识符。 3. book_sort:用于存储图书的类型,如类型编号(主键)与类别名称等数据。 4. borrow:记录学生借阅的信息,包含学籍编码及书籍序列码作为联合主键,并且有借书日期和预期归还日志字段。 5. return_table:保存学生的实际归还信息,包括读者编号、图书序号以及具体借出与还款时间点。 6. ticket:存储超期罚款记录,涉及学生编号、书籍编码及相应的逾期天数和罚金金额等项。 7. manager:包含管理员的标识符(主键)、姓名、年龄和联系方式。 为了提升查询效率,在相关表上建立了索引。例如在student表中为stu_id创建升序索引,并且为stu_name创建降序索引,以此提高系统的性能表现。 通过这项设计工作,我们不仅掌握了数据库的基本概念与关系模型的运用方法,还学会了如何将E-R图转化为实际的数据表格和优化查询效率的技术。这能够有效地支持图书馆日常业务运作并提升服务质量及工作效率。